Proper Application Of Cat Tick And Flea Control Products

Cats are animals that are prone to numerous diseases that can be trivial or severe. One of these conditions is tick and flea infections. Ticks and fleas are parasites that tend to thrive on animals’ skin, fur, or coat. These pests suck blood from their hosts to survive and reproduce. Removing them from the animals’ skin may be difficult because these tiny pests may be hardheaded. So what should be done with these parasites?

Experts have developed numerous products that can help address tick and flea infections. Since there are several available in the market, you may need to consider several elements such as the following:

· Read the labels on the products.

· Buy the correct dosage for your feline.

· Use products that are approved by your vet, in consideration of your pet’s weight, health status, and age.

Ensure that the products you will use are made for cats. There are several items that are developed for dogs, and these are those that can be toxic for cats. Work with your vet  Washington DC in creating a flea preventive program that will give year-round protection for your pet.
